Output 95ede289f5eb72a028df060b4c565897747628c8ac228bd695f144e875925c41:25

value
606454
script pubkey
OP_0 OP_PUSHBYTES_20 6c2050aa99aef6929a90d421202afa9d0379489f
address
ltc1qdss9p25e4mmf9x5s6ssjq2h6n5phjjylwspju6
transaction
95ede289f5eb72a028df060b4c565897747628c8ac228bd695f144e875925c41
spent
true